The index that's used in this recipe is ... WebParent aggregation. A special single bucket aggregation that selects parent documents that have the specified type, as defined in a join field. This aggregation has a single option: type - The child type that should be selected. For example, let’s say we have an index of questions and answers. WebJul 22, 2024 · Hi Slobbard, nested and parent/child are 2 different approaches to joins. Nested is about storing related content in the same JSON but storing as neighbouring Lucene documents in an index. Parent/child is about storing parents and children in different JSON docs but routing them to the same shard.
